What are the Key Features of a Concealable Vest?
A concealable vest provides the wearer with optimal functionality and comfort. Its lightweight design allows unrestricted movement, essential for stealth operations. The MOLLE (Modular Lightweight Load-carrying Equipment) system on these vests enables easy attachment of accessories, such as magazine pouches, med kits, and utility pouches. Additionally, reinforced stitching and durable materials ensure a long-lasting vest that can handle the challenges of covert operations. How do I Optimize Gear Placement on a MOLLE Rig?
Optimizing gear placement on your MOLLE rig is vital for quick and easy access to your equipment. Tactical Enclave recommends organizing your gear based on priority and frequency of use. Placing regularly used items within easy reach improves operational efficiency. Research and results have shown that positioning your gear strategically helps distribute the weight evenly, preventing strain on your body during prolonged operations. What fabric is best for a low-profile assault rig?
Choosing the right fabric for a low-profile assault rig is crucial for achieving optimal performance in covert operations. The most recommended fabric for these rigs is a lightweight and durable material such as 500D nylon. This fabric is not only sturdy and tear-resistant, but it also offers excellent water repellency and quick drying capabilities.
